Eldorado Gold Corporation (TSX:ELD) exercised its option to acquire 75% stake in Bruell gold project, east of Val D?Or, Québec from Sparton Resources Inc. (TSXV:SRI) on April 18, 2024.
Eldorado Gold Corporation (TSX:ELD) completed the acquisition of stake in Bruell gold project, east of Val D?Or, Québec from Sparton Resources Inc. (TSXV:SRI) on May 29, 2025. Eldorado Gold Corporation acquired the remaining 25% interest in the Bruell Gold Project from Sparton Resources Inc.
Eldorado Gold Corporation is a Canada-based gold and base metals producer with mining, development and exploration operations in Canada, Greece and Turkiye. The Company operates four mines: Kisladag and Efemcukuru located in western Turkiye, the Lamaque Complex in Quebec (Lamaque), Canada, and Olympias located in Northern Greece. Kisladag, Efemcukuru and Lamaque are gold mines, while Olympias is a polymetallic operation producing three concentrates bearing gold, lead-silver and zinc. Complementing its producing portfolio is its advanced stage copper-gold development project, Skouries, in Northern Greece. Its other development projects in its portfolio include Perama Hill, a wholly owned gold-silver project in Greece. Its McIlvenna Bay Deposit is a copper-zinc-gold-silver deposit. The McIlvenna Bay Property sits approximately 65 kilometers (km) West of Flin Flon, Manitoba. The McIlvenna Bay Property is part of the prolific Flin Flon Greenstone Belt located in east-central Saskatchewan.
